Transaction e1072997916cbe52ebd9789c08b1961e2db838e1fa2cb050a9c39d99efc219a8

3 Input
2 Outputs
  • e1072997916cbe52ebd9789c08b1961e2db838e1fa2cb050a9c39d99efc219a8:0
  • value  27087139
    address  3HRYCtKwE5TtUEQAay4fJHPFcXwR25VsgN
  • e1072997916cbe52ebd9789c08b1961e2db838e1fa2cb050a9c39d99efc219a8:1
  • value  2757635954
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g